Celeste Rivas Hernandez was 14 years old when she disappeared in April 2025. Five months later, her badly decomposed body was found in the trunk of a car that was left registered to singer David Burke, a 21-year-old known to millions of TikTok fans as D4vd.

Burke has pleaded not guilty to murder, mutilation and child sexual abuse. He appeared in a Los Angeles court on Tuesday for a trial that could last several days, during which the district attorney’s office must show a judge that it has enough evidence to prosecute the case.

In court briefs, prosecutors laid out what they called the “shocking steps” Burke took after the murder. They say he put the girl’s body in a green inflatable pool “to prevent blood from spilling into his garage,” then removed the body parts with a chainsaw “and possibly other tools.” A dam, two saws, a shovel and a cadaver bag were purchased online under a false name and delivered to his home, according to the document.

Burke was the last person to drive the car on July 29, 2025, prosecutors said, before he left it near his home and went on a concert tour. Weeks later it was pulled into a containment area, where workers smelled a foul smell and notified authorities on September 8.

“We believe that the real evidence will show that David Burke did not kill Celeste Rivas Hernandez, and he is not the cause of her death,” said defense attorney Blair Berk during the April 20 hearing.

Burke found fame at a young age in 2022 when the songs he recorded on his phone for his Fortnite gameplay videos went viral, and his song “Romantic Homicide” helped him sign with Interscope Records. He performed at Coachella last year, less than two weeks before prosecutors said he was responsible for the murder.
